About the Employer

Mission/ Vision: We believe highly qualified teachers and top performing support staff are the key to student achievement. In alignment with the VCUSD Strategic plan, the Human Resources Department allocates resources, provides daily guidance and support to all District employees. Through proactive and engaging recruitment and retention efforts, we continue to promote a safe, supportive, and engaging learning environment. Our goal is to provide excellent customer service through timely, accurate, and respectful communications. Goal: To provide effective and efficient procession of applicants, and prompt completion of hiring steps. We want to ensure that all employees receive excellent support services leading to high retention rates.

Requirements / Qualifications

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E: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science or related field required; coursework in digital media, web design, and/or computer programming highly preferred. Equivalent progressive professional experience may be substituted for education

  • Copy of Transcript (Bachelor's Degree or Transcript )
  • Letter(s) of Recommendation (Three (3) Letters of Recommendation)
  • Proof of HS Graduation (High School or Equivalent. HS Transcripts acceptable. College Transcripts can be submitted in lieu of High School Documents)
  • Resume (Resume)
